image

编辑人: 长安花落尽

calendar2025-07-20

message3

visits64

数据库表空间管理备考全攻略

在数据库系统的学习和备考过程中,表空间管理是一个重要的知识点。本文将详细介绍数据库表空间管理的核心内容,包括表空间的创建、数据文件的添加、以及表空间的扩容与收缩方法,帮助考生全面掌握这一关键技能。

一、表空间概念及重要性

首先,我们需要明确什么是表空间。在数据库中,表空间是逻辑存储单元,用于组织和管理数据库对象(如表、索引等)。合理管理表空间对于优化数据存储、提高数据库性能具有重要意义。

二、表空间创建

创建表空间是表空间管理的基础操作。在创建表空间时,需要指定表空间的名称、初始大小、自动扩展方式等参数。例如,在Oracle数据库中,可以使用CREATE TABLESPACE语句来创建表空间。创建时,应考虑业务的特性和数据的增长趋势,为不同的业务数据创建独立的表空间,以便于管理和维护。

三、数据文件添加

数据文件是表空间中存储数据的物理文件。在表空间创建后,可能需要向其中添加数据文件以满足数据存储的需求。添加数据文件时,需要注意数据文件的初始大小、自动扩展设置等,以确保数据文件能够满足业务增长的需求。

四、表空间扩容与收缩

随着业务的不断发展和数据的不断增长,可能需要对表空间进行扩容或收缩。扩容是指增加表空间的大小,以满足更多的数据存储需求。在Oracle数据库中,可以通过添加数据文件或扩展现有数据文件的大小来实现表空间的扩容。而收缩则是指减小表空间的大小,以释放不必要的存储空间。但需要注意的是,不是所有的数据库系统都支持表空间的收缩操作,因此在执行前需要仔细了解数据库系统的特性和限制。

五、学习建议

在备考过程中,考生应重点关注表空间管理的实践操作,通过模拟实验和实际项目来加深对知识点的理解和记忆。同时,多做练习题,尤其是那些涉及表空间创建、数据文件管理和扩容收缩的题目,有助于提高解题速度和准确率。

总之,掌握数据库表空间管理对于成为一名优秀的数据库系统工程师至关重要。希望本文能为大家的备考提供有益的帮助。

喵呜刷题:让学习像火箭一样快速,快来微信扫码,体验免费刷题服务,开启你的学习加速器!

创作类型:
原创

本文链接:数据库表空间管理备考全攻略

版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。
分享文章
share